作者:Kurosaki 本文主要讲解Electron 窗口的 API 和一些在开发之中遇到的问题。 官方文档 虽然比较全面,但是要想开发一个商用级别的桌面应用必须对整个 Electron API 有较深的了解,才能应对各种需求。 1. 创建窗口 通过BrowserWindow ...
作者:梁棒棒 简介 electron打包工具有两个:electron builder,electron packager,官方还提到electron forge,其实它不是一个打包工具,而是一个类似于cli的工具集,目的是简化开发到打包的一整套流程,内部打包工具依然是electron packager。 electron builder与electron packager相比各有优劣,elect ...
2020-12-22 09:03 1 695 推荐指数:
作者:Kurosaki 本文主要讲解Electron 窗口的 API 和一些在开发之中遇到的问题。 官方文档 虽然比较全面,但是要想开发一个商用级别的桌面应用必须对整个 Electron API 有较深的了解,才能应对各种需求。 1. 创建窗口 通过BrowserWindow ...
作者:Kurosaki 本节旨在汇总在开发Electron 窗口可能遇到的问题,做一个汇总,后续遇到问题会持续更新。 1. 窗口闪烁问题。 使用new BrowserWindow() 创建出窗口,如果不作任何配置的话,窗口就会出现,默认是白色的;这个时候使用 ...
打包Electron应用### 1、全局安装electron-packager npm install -g electron-packager 2、在项目目录下执行命令 electron-packager ./ --platform=win32 --arch=ia32 ...
当前环境Debian Linux-Deepin 安装Node 直接下载 命令下载 下载 解压,解压后在当前盘多了个文件夹node-v14.15.1-linux-x64.(可自行改名) ...
electron和vue整合项目的打包方式: 首先,打包方式不止这一种,我就说一下我打包成功的那种,嘻嘻~~ 1、全局安装electron-builder打包工具:npm install -g electron-builder 2、在项目根目录下的package.json文件中配置打包相关 ...
提示:Application entry file "main.js" does not exist 解决: package.json中的build模块,添加files 提示:Application entry file "build/electron.js" does ...
路由问题: 打包成electron前,需要修改 index.html 成 这样按照教程,确实能打包成功。 但是!但是。 此时从浏览器 直接访问 127.0.0.1:4000 也就是index是没问题的;而且从index页开始点击操作,各种路由 ...
本文采用electron结合angular-electron框架开发桌面应用。electron开发的客户端可以跨平台,一套代码可以打包成不同操作系统的应用包括主流的:windows,mac,linux。通过 electron-builder模块进行打包 ...